Milton Mill, 87, of Creamery, PA died December 26, 2007 in Pottstown Memorial Hospital.
Born in Philadelphia, he was the son of the late Israel and Rose (Moil) Mill. He was a graduate of Overbrook High School and attended Temple University. Milton was the co-owner of a dressed poultry business with his brother, Lawrence in Creamery, PA for many years. He was a U.S. Army veteran of WW II.
Milton is survived by one nephew, Ronald Aaron and his wife Marilyn Aaron, Brookline, MA. There is also one great niece, Dr. Robin Altman and her husband Dr. Adam Altman, Wyomissing, PA; and one great nephew, Arthur Aaron and his wife Deborah Aaron, Arlington, MA; three great-great nephews and one great-great niece. His longtime companion, Margaret Nester, Creamery, PA also survives him.
